Output 3df3aed7a0184f670b7ce6d2dbd8c561d0aba77249473d2f199bdb91b0ca1cf8:0

value
27084756
script pubkey
OP_0 OP_PUSHBYTES_20 dad5940be4b7b2a011e63697429c6051500f298e
address
bc1qmt2egzlyk7e2qy0xx6t598rq29gq72vwct83vf
transaction
3df3aed7a0184f670b7ce6d2dbd8c561d0aba77249473d2f199bdb91b0ca1cf8
spent
true